Invictus International School (Horizon Hills)

Invictus International School Horizon Hills is located in Horizon Hills, Iskandar Puteri, Johor, Malaysia, providing education in an environment where nature and urban life harmonize. Since opening in January 2023, it has attracted attention as a rapidly growing school with over 700 students.
The school implements the Cambridge curriculum (Cambridge Primary / Lower Secondary / IGCSE / A-Levels), developing logical thinking, creativity, and global perspectives. Through diverse programs including inquiry-based learning, STEM, languages, and leadership, the school provides an environment that nurtures each student’s talents.
Courses
Kindergarten

For ages 3-5, the program emphasizes developing children’s self-directed learning abilities. Centered on inquiry-based learning, creativity, collaboration, and language skills are developed through play. In an English-speaking environment, students naturally acquire language skills through daily conversation and expressive activities. Group activities for developing social skills and programs supporting emotional growth are also well-established.
Primary School

For ages 5-11, classes are based on the Cambridge Primary curriculum. In addition to foundational skills in English, mathematics, and science, learning is provided across a wide range of fields including ICT, music, art, and PE. Practical learning and discussions are emphasized to develop students’ ability to think and solve problems independently. Many opportunities are also provided to develop multicultural understanding and presentation skills to foster international perspectives.
Secondary School

For ages 11-18, the school adopts a systematic international curriculum progressing from Cambridge Lower Secondary through IGCSE to A-Levels. Education emphasizes not only academic depth but also logical thinking and leadership development. Students select subjects according to their interests and develop skills for their future paths. Additionally, abundant opportunities for developing responsibility and initiative are provided through community service activities and extracurricular projects.

Basic Information
| Address | No. 3 Persiaran Selatan, Horizon Hills Iskandar Puteri, 79100, Johor Bahru, Malaysia |
| Phone | +60 10 882 8721 |
| Website | Visit Website |
| Age Range | Kindergarten (Ages 3-5) Primary Year 1-6 (Ages 5-11) Secondary Year 7-13 (Ages 11-18) |
| Class Size | 20-25 students |
| Teacher Nationalities | Many international teachers |
| School Hours | Kindergarten: 08:10 – 14:00 Primary-Secondary: 08:10 – 15:00 Extra-curricular: 15:30-16:30 |
| Academic Year | 2-term system (August, January) |
| Curriculum | British: IGCSE, A Level (EAL available for additional fee) |
| Admission | CAT4, Interview |
| Fee Discounts | Sibling Discount: 2nd child: 5% tuition discount 3rd child onwards: 10% tuition discount |
| Second Languages | Malay, Chinese |
| Boarding | None |

Tuition Fees (2025/2026)
*Exchange rate: RM1 = 35 JPY
| Year | Annual Tuition (2 terms) |
| Nursery | RM22,500 (JPY 787,500) |
| Kindergarten | RM23,500 (JPY 822,500) |
| Year 1 | RM26,500 (JPY 927,500) |
| Year 2 | RM28,500 (JPY 997,500) |
| Year 3 | RM30,500 (JPY 1,067,500) |
| Year 4 | RM32,500 (JPY 1,137,500) |
| Year 5 | RM34,500 (JPY 1,207,500) |
| Year 6 | RM36,500 (JPY 1,277,500) |
| Year 7 | RM39,500 (JPY 1,382,500) |
| Year 8 | RM41,500 (JPY 1,452,500) |
| Year 9 | RM43,500 (JPY 1,522,500) |
| Year 10 | RM45,500 (JPY 1,592,500) |
| Year 11 | RM45,500 (JPY 1,592,500) |
| Year 12 | RM48,500 (JPY 1,697,500) |
| Year 13 | RM48,500 (JPY 1,697,500) |
